Common Poolpy Hazard.exe Errors on Windows

Dealing with Poolpy Hazard.exe errors can often be perplexing, given the variety of issues that might cause them. They can range from a mere software glitch to a more serious malware intrusion. Here, we've compiled a list of the most common errors associated with Poolpy Hazard.exe to help you navigate and possibly fix these issues.

  • Poolpy Hazard.exe - System Error: This error is usually associated with missing or corrupted system files required by Poolpy Hazard.exe.
  • Application Not Found: This message occurs when the system can't find the necessary application. Possible reasons could be the application being deleted, moved, or an inaccurately specified file path.
  • Error 0xc0000142: This warning surfaces when there's an issue with an application starting up correctly. This might be due to issues within the application, corruption of related files, or problems associated with the Windows registry.
  • Runtime Errors: These errors occur during the runtime of an .exe file. These can be due to software bugs, memory problems, or hardware issues.
  • Error 0xc0000005: Also known as Access Violation Error, it happens when the application tries to access the location of the memory that is already used by another .exe file, which results in a conflict.

Run a System File Checker (SFC) to Fix the Poolpy Hazard.exe Error

Run a System File Checker (SFC) to Fix the Poolpy Hazard.exe Error Thumbnail
Difficulty
Expert
Steps
7
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
3
Description

In this guide, we will attempt to fix the Poolpy Hazard.exe error by scanning Windows system files.

Step 1: Open Command Prompt

Step 1: Open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run SFC Scan

Step 2: Run SFC Scan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type sfc /scannow and press Enter.

  2. Allow the System File Checker to scan your system for errors.

Step 3: Review Results and Repair Errors

Step 3: Review Results and Repair Errors Thumbnail
  1. Review the scan results once completed.

  2. Follow the on-screen instructions to repair any errors found.
